#EkitiDecides: PDP candidate Bisi Kolawole wins polling unit

Mr Kolawole scored 98 votes to beat the candidate of the APC, Biodun Oyebanji, who garnered 13 votes.

The cand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in the ongoing Ekiti governorship election, Bisi Kolawole, has won in his polling.

Mr Kolawole, who voted at polling unit 01, ward 8, in Efon Local Government Area of the state, scored 98 votes to beat the candidate of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Biodun Oyebanji, who garnered 13 votes. 

Following in a distant third place was the Social Democratic Party (SDP) candidate, Segun Oni, who polled two votes out of the 116 accredited voters at the polling units. 

Mr Kolawole, had earlier boasted that he would win the ongoing governorship election exercise, stating that Ekiti residents were in dire need of a change.
